Quillstream, our internal message queue, retains only the latest record per key on compacted topics. The compactor runs every six hours and removes superseded records, which matters for security review because deleted-user tombstones are only guaranteed purged after a full compaction pass plus the 24-hour grace window. Compaction status and tombstone audit reports are exposed through the Quillstream admin API, which requires service-level authentication. For reviewer access to the audit endpoints, use the key below.

gateway credential: kto7_GoY89Me

### Log sampling on Pipewren

When Pipewren floods the aggregator, enable sampling via the admin API rather than restarting the service. Set sample_rate to 0.1 for bursts, restore to 1.0 afterward, and note the change in the ops journal. The sampling endpoint requires authentication; use the bearer token below.

bearer token for kawig-yajef: eyJhbGciOiJIUzI1NiIsInR5cCI6IkpXVCJ9.eyJzdWIiOiI8HQhnz97dxIn0.tsXu5Xf2tmo0

## Add bounce classifier to Mailrook pipeline

This PR adds a processor that sorts inbound bounce notifications into hard and soft categories before they hit the suppression list. New folks: the classifier runs after ingestion but before retry scheduling, so suppression is always authoritative. Retry backoff and batch sizing are controlled by the constants below.

tuning constants:
QUOTAS = {
    "druwyn": 5,
    "holix": 5,
    "zorath": 5,
    "holwyn": 10,
}

## Changed defaults — cron drift investigation (Tardel scheduler)

Following the drift investigation on the Marloft batch hosts, we changed several scheduler defaults. Previously, jobs inherited host-local time, which allowed unsynchronized clocks to skew execution windows by up to four minutes. Defaults now pin all schedules to the coordinator's monotonic clock, and drift beyond thirty seconds triggers an audit event rather than silent correction. For the security review, the effective configuration after this change is listed below.

settings of faweg-tahop:
ISTAX_PIN=8134
ISTAX_METRICS_HOST=metrics.istax.tolvaqcorp.internal
ISTAX_LOG_LEVEL=debug
ISTAX_TENANT=caseth